4 reasons why your Acne situation is not improving

Acne is something we are all familiar with. Regardless of the reason behind it, or its cause, its safe to say that we have all experienced it at least once in our lifetime. From whiteheads, blackheads, blemishes, to even full-blown pimples, we’ve gone through it all. For some, it may last a few days and disappear soon after. But for others, it may become a recurring part of their lives. Although, most of it can be attributed to uncontrollable reasons, recurring or unhinged acne could also be due to external factors that you can alter. In this article, we explore some common reasons as to why your acne situation is not improving.

Acne can be caused by a variety of reasons, including:

Usage of wrong products or following wrong skin routines

Using over-the-counter medications/creams, or the ones recommended by friends and family, can cause your acne to worsen. Since acne has various causes, it would be silly to use your friends’ or family’s products as your skin needs would be different from theirs. Unless your products have been prescribed by a doctor, it is advisable to refrain from using recommended products as they may hinder your skin’s healing capabilities while also worsening your acne situation.

Following a proper skin routine is also a vital step in helping your acne. While some may benefit from a simple face wash, you may need more extensive skin care depending on your acne needs. It is often advisable to refrain from blindly following others’ routines as they may prove useless to your skin and could also end up making your acne harsher down the line. Always make it a point to consult a doctor to understand the root cause of your acne, so that respective products and routines can be followed to ensure maximum results.

Improper or lack of good hygiene

Apart from take care of your skin through the right products and routines, you should also make it a point to maintain cleanliness in your surroundings. Some steps you could follow would include frequently washing your pillowcases, keeping your makeup brushes clean and dry, avoiding mixing of makeup products and brushes amongst friends and family, etc. By inculcating such steps into your lifestyle, you can tackle those external factors that could affect your skin’s condition and help your acne positively.

Unbalanced and unhealthy diets

Having the right products and following the right skincare regiment may not always yield desired results. In such a case, it would be advisable to take a look at your dietary habits, as the wrong move could affect your skin’s health. For instance, having too much sugary foods can affect your insulin levels, which can in turn cause hormonal imbalance that leads to acne formation. Dairy products, as well as oily foods, are also known to aggravate acne in many. Hence it is always recommended to follow a healthy lifestyle, maintaining a healthy weight and a balanced diet.

Underlying health conditions or hormonal acne

In many cases, your acne might be the cause of underlying health conditions that can affect your skin’s health, making it prone to acne. For instance, endocrine related conditions and disorders could drastically affect your acne as it directly tampers with your hormone levels. A common endocrine disorder, often observed in women, is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S) which has been noticed to worsen the skin’s acne situation. In order to identify and treat your conditions, it is advisable to consult a doctor, who can give you an accurate rundown of your acne’s root cause and the appropriate treatments/remedies to tackle it.

Getting a proper skin diagnosis, as well as a prescribed skincare regiment, can definitely help you tackle your skin troubles and acne situation. Apart from that, here are a few preventive measures you can inculcate into your lifestyle to aid your acne recovery journey:

  • Limit sun exposure
  • Wash your face with mild cleansers, but don’t over wash
  • Reduce stress levels
  • Maintain a healthy lifestyle with a balanced diet and exercise
  • Stay hydrated
  • Limit the use of cosmetics
  • Do not pop any pimples
  • Consider acne treatments including facials, laser therapies etc.
